Drain line replacement services involve removing and installing new drainage pipes that carry wastewater from a property to the main sewer line or septic system. This process typically includes excavating the affected area, removing the old or damaged pipes, and installing new piping that meets current standards. Professionals may also perform inspections to identify underlying issues and ensure that the new drain line is correctly connected and functioning properly. The goal is to restore proper drainage flow and prevent future problems related to sewer backups or leaks.

This service addresses common problems such as cracked, collapsed, or corroded drain lines, which can cause blockages, foul odors, or water damage. Over time, pipes may deteriorate due to age, ground shifting, or root intrusion, leading to frequent clogs or sewage backups. Replacing the drain line can eliminate persistent drainage issues and reduce the risk of costly repairs or property damage. Proper installation also helps ensure compliance with local plumbing codes and promotes long-term reliability of the drainage system.

The overview below groups typical Drain Line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lakewood,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ost Range - Drain line replacement typically costs between $1,200 and $4,500, depending on the length and complexity of the pipe. For example, replacing a standard residential drain line may fall around $2,000 to $3,000.

Material Expenses - The choice of materials impacts the overall cost, with PVC pipes generally costing less than cast iron or copper. Material costs can range from $10 to $50 per foot, influencing the total project price.

Labor Costs - Labor expenses for drain line replacement usually account for 50% to 70% of the total cost. In Lakewood, CO, labor fees may vary from $60 to $150 per hour, depending on the contractor.

Additional Fees - Extra charges may apply for permits, excavation, or dealing with difficult access points. These additional costs can add $300 to $1,000 or more to the overall project budget.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that a drain line needs to be replaced? Signs may include persistent clogs, foul odors, water backups, or visible damage to the drain pipe.

How long does a drain line replacement typically take? The duration depends on the extent of the work, but most replacements can be completed within a day by professional service providers.

Is drain line replacement disruptive to my property? Some disruption is possible, such as minor excavation or access to plumbing areas, but experienced pros aim to minimize inconvenience.

What should I consider when choosing a service provider for drain line replacement? It’s important to select a reputable local contractor with experience in drain line services and good customer reviews.

Does replacing a drain line require any permits? Permit requirements vary by location; a local service provider can advise on the necessary approvals for drain line replacement in Lakewood, CO, and nearby areas.
